March 14, 201412 yr Hey everyone, Got the product the other day and I love it! However, I have a problem. I am trying to all the sound coming out of my speakers, and be able to just use the headset for commands. Now, everything seems to be working fine... I set up my speakers as the default playback, and the headset as default record, all is right in the world. I boot up the aircraft, all of the sound is working as it's supposed to, then boom. The FO will turn on the aircraft's power and all sound goes to my headset. What am I doing wrong? I can't have crew talking to me and Vatsim ATC yelling at me at the same time! March 14, 201412 yr This could be that your sound card is not set to use the speakers at the same time as the headset. To change this you need to open your soundcard settings. Look for something that says something like "Independent Headset" Then you need to check your FSX settings and also FS2Crew's settings. If your soundcard is set correctly then you can check the following. Check your FSX sound settings and make sure that they are set to the correct values. It would be also worth checking that FS2Crew is set correctly also. To check your FSX settings click on "Settings" then "Sound" Make sure that the drop down boxes are set as you want them to be. For FS2Crew click on "CFG" then check the audio setup value is set to your headset device. IF ALL THAT DOESN'T WORK TRY THIS. Unplug your headphones and play a video on youtube. The audio should come through your speakers. Then whilst the video is still playing plug your headphones in. If the audio comes through the headphones then you need to check your sound card settings again. If the audio still plays through your speakers then it should work as described above. March 14, 201412 yr Author OK. I went and did everything you said. Here's the exact problem. When I went on Youtube, everything was fine and sound came from my speakers. When I went on FSX, everything is fine and sound came from my speakers. When I loaded the aircraft up, everything's fine. When I started up Fs2Crew, everything changes everything stops coming out of the speakers except for the FO's voice, which comes blaring out of the speakers. So, in summary. Engine and switches noise: Headphones FO and all other FS2crew sounds: Speakers. It's really annoying! How is this all turned around? EDIT: I felt I should expand on the settings I have marked. I have my Realtek Speakers as the default playback and my headphones as default Record on my Computer. I have Realtek Selected as Sound and Headphones selected as voice in FSX, and I have Headphones selected in the FS2crew CFG. P.S. I know this is a possibility because I play iRacing with all sounds going through the speakers except for my voice in the headset.
